Wings West kit is just a replica of the Mugen kit made specifically for the Honda CRX. In my opinion, it looks good heh. Do some custom modifications to the front bumper...make it flush and cut for some EF9 Front bumper lights and get some of the EF9 Fenders w/ sidemarkers and ur set.
